Second, the analysis of the class students: Based on the analysis of the actual situation of the students in the third grade at the end of the term, the students' learning mentality is not stable, and there are many mistakes that are eager to achieve success, mainly reflected in the multiplication of algebra median and double digits. Students use the draft book improperly, and hasty calculation is prone to errors. Some students confuse multiplication with addition. This problem makes students easy to make mistakes when calculating the thousands of numbers involved in the average. In solving problems (application problems), some students often write them down in a hurry without reading and understanding the problems, which leads to mistakes, especially in flexible regional problems. It is worth noting that the phenomenon of polarization has gradually emerged this semester. Excellent students can learn new knowledge easily, use it freely and have good study habits. Secondary school students have solid knowledge and can study independently, but their thinking is not flexible enough and they lack problem consciousness. Underachievers are slow to accept knowledge, not good at thinking and solving problems independently, and their academic performance is unstable and steep. Therefore, we should pay attention to both ends when reviewing, not only to make up the difference, but also to cultivate Excellence. Third, review the key difficulties and key points (1). Fourth, review content: (1) Preliminary understanding of numbers 1, decimals and fractions, and addition and subtraction operations. 2. Multiplication of two digits and two or three digits; Division and mixed operation between one digit and two or three digits (2) Preliminary understanding of space and figure 1 and simple figure, and understanding of its basic characteristics. 2. Understanding the perimeter of graphics and calculating the perimeter of rectangles and squares. 3. To understand the meaning of area, you can use optional graphic units to estimate and measure the graphic area, understand the necessity of unifying the area units, know and understand the area units, and carry out simple area conversion; By exploring and mastering the area formulas of rectangles and squares, we can estimate the area of a given rectangle and square. (3) Statistics Through abundant examples, I can understand the meaning of averages and realize the necessity of learning averages. I can get the average of simple data, ask and answer simple questions according to the data in the statistical chart, and exchange my ideas with my peers. (4) Combining practical activities with real life cases, using the knowledge learned to analyze and solve problems, and forming certain problem-solving strategies. V.
